Last Listing description (January 2025)

Located on the corner of Shadforth Street and Adelaide Street, this charming period cottage was one of the first private homes built in Westbury in an area referred to in the town as 'The Ritchies'.

Offering lovely rural views from the front verandah of this early 1850s cottage, towards and within a short walking distance of Westbury Village Green and Town Common. Filled with sun for most of the day- morning sun into the aptly named sunroom/dining room and afternoon westerly sun into the bedrooms. Some of the original charms of the home are still visible the beautiful hardwood flooring, concrete window aprons and window lead lighting.

Although the kitchen is original it is a perfectly functional room with loads of space and as it adjoins the sunroom/dining room there is potential to re-configure if you choose.

Practical family bathroom with a shower over bath and large wet room which could be re-configured back into a laundry.

The sleeping accommodation is flexible, with 3 designated bedrooms offering comfort for the professional couple or growing family.

Your choice of gorgeous radiant heat comes from either an open wood fire or the built-in Saxon woodfire and if the fire goes out there is a choice of two reverse cycle air conditioning units to take the chill off the winter air.

The secure flat yard offers a low maintenance garden, established mature trees and loads of space for children or pets to enjoy.

The brick bungalow, separate to the house, would make a great sleep out for guests, a teenagers retreat, study/office, or perhaps additional short-term accommodation (STCA).

There is another outbuilding that backs off the freestanding single garage 2 rooms that could be used for additional storage with a second toilet.

The classic 19th-century village is a lovely reminder of old England with its hawthorn hedgerows, narrow lanes, tree lined streets and its many elegant properties. Walk to the local school, the Post Office, the Heritage listed Village Green, bus stop and to some of the charming local shops that Westbury is becoming known for - Western Tiers Distillery, Little Marneys Town & Country gift store and Love Lucy Boots, touted to be the best coffee in the Meander Valley area.

This represents a unique opportunity to live within a thriving, growing community and with Launceston a 25-minute drive away, and Devonport a 45 minute one, the "big smoke" is well within reach when you need it to be.

About Westbury 7303

The size of Westbury is approximately 93.4 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 0.3% of total area. The population of Westbury in 2016 was 2006 people. By 2021 the population was 2272 showing a population growth of 13.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Westbury is 60-69 years. Households in Westbury are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Westbury work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 76.20% of the homes in Westbury were owner-occupied compared with 74.50% in 2016.
